Barry M Quick Dry
Colours- Full Throttle (Peach/Orange) - Lap Of Honour (Purple) - Kiss Me Quick (Pink)

These nail polishes are amazing! I have a love/hate relationship with Barry M. I've found that some of their newer collections are not of great quality. Sometimes my nails chip so easily depending which polish I go for, however this new range is completely different! They last about 3-4 days without chipping and they dry extremely quickly. At first I thought the finish would be quite matte because most fast drying nail polishes tend to be but they are actually quite shiny! The range has mostly pastel colours which I think is perfect for the spring and summer!



Barry M Gelly Hi-Shine
Colour- Blueberry

I love this colour for spring time, It is the perfect medium between pastel and vibrant colours. It has a very high shine but again this is one of the Barry M ranges that I find chips extremely quickly so you will need a bottom and top coat of clear polish to avoid this problem. I tend to use the O.P.I Nail Envy top coat strengthener.  



Rimmel 60 Second Dry
Colour- 504 Districtly Come Dancing

A perfect turquoise colour for spring time. I always love wearing these colours to add a bit of pop to a boring outfit. I'm not sure about the 60 second dry though... whenever I have used this it just takes around the same time to dry as normal nail polish. It has a really high quality shine and again looks great with a clear top coat. I don't find that this polish chips quickly but it does need at least 2 coats for the colour to look as bold as it does in the bottle!



Maybelline Colour Show
Colour- 110 Urban Coral

My mum actually picked up this nail polish for about 40p in a sale and it's such a beautiful colour. This one is definitely my favourite colour for spring time at the moment. It is a really bold coral colour and lasts for so long with a top coat. It has a really high shine and looks amazing on any skin tone.
